The Technology Behind Mobile LED Lighting Towers

Mobile LED lighting towers are built on advanced lighting technology that significantly enhances illumination efficiency compared to traditional lighting solutions. At the core of these towers are high-output LED lamps that provide superior brightness while consuming a fraction of the energy that conventional halogen or incandescent bulbs would require. LED technology operates on a fundamentally different principle; rather than generating heat as a byproduct of light production, LEDs convert almost all the energy they consume directly into visible light. This remarkable efficiency translates into lower operational costs and a reduced carbon footprint.

Moreover, modern mobile LED lighting towers incorporate intelligent features such as variable output settings and timers. This allows users to adjust the intensity of the light based on environmental requirements, further conserving energy. For instance, on job sites where high visibility is not always essential, operators can reduce brightness and extend the operational time of the lighting system without sacrificing visibility. By providing tailored illumination, these towers ensure that energy is only used as needed, aligning with both economic and environmental goals.

Built-in monitoring systems often accompany these lighting solutions, offering real-time data on performance and energy usage. Such systems empower operators to make informed decisions, adjusting their lighting strategies dynamically based on specific project requirements. As a result, the operational efficiency of work sites using mobile LED lighting towers is markedly elevated, demonstrating how technology can transform simple illumination into a strategic advantage.

Improving Safety and Efficiency on Job Sites

Safety remains a paramount concern on any job site, especially when work extends into the nighttime hours or low-light conditions. Insufficient lighting not only hampers productivity but presents substantial risks, including accidents, injuries, and decreased worker morale. Mobile LED lighting towers address these challenges head-on by providing bright, uniform light that illuminates large work areas effectively.

The wide distribution of light helps eliminate shadows that can obscure hazards, allowing workers to navigate more safely and with greater confidence. This quality of light is particularly crucial in industries like construction and mining, where the presence of heavy machinery and uneven terrain makes visibility vital. Improved safety translates to reduced accidents, which ultimately saves time and money associated with workers’ compensation claims and project delays.

Additionally, the ability to quickly deploy mobile LED lighting towers enhances operational efficiency. Unlike stationary lighting solutions that require extensive installation, these towers can be transported easily between various work sites, allowing for rapid setup and breakdown. This kind of flexibility is essential in industries where project timelines are tight and unpredictable, ensuring that operations can proceed smoothly regardless of the conditions outside. In high-stakes environments, reducing downtime is not just a benefit; it is a requirement for success.

Reducing Environmental Impact Through Efficient Lighting

The increasing emphasis on corporate social responsibility has prompted businesses to reconsider their energy consumption and overall environmental impact. Mobile LED lighting towers align seamlessly with these sustainability initiatives. As mentioned, the energy efficiency of LEDs drastically reduces electricity usage, directly contributing to lower greenhouse gas emissions. This benefit is a compelling reason for businesses in sectors such as construction and events to invest in modern lighting solutions.

In terms of lifespan, LED bulbs outlast traditional lighting sources significantly, with some lasting up to 50,000 hours or more. This prolonged lifespan means fewer replacements, leading to less waste generated by burned-out bulbs and lower resource consumption associated with manufacturing new lighting units. Mobile LED lighting towers are often designed with durability in mind; many models are weather-resistant, allowing them to operate efficiently under various conditions and reducing the need for frequent maintenance.

Moreover, some models include solar charging capabilities, further diminishing their dependence on conventional power sources. These innovations not only showcase a commitment to environmental responsibility but can also yield cost savings in energy expenditure. As policies worldwide increasingly favor businesses with sustainable practices, installing mobile LED lighting towers can enhance a company’s reputation and enable it to thrive in an eco-conscious marketplace.

Applications Across Various Industries

The versatility of mobile LED lighting towers makes them applicable in a wide array of situations and industries. In construction, for example, these lighting solutions provide illumination for complex projects that may require working longer hours to meet deadlines, especially in densely populated urban environments. The mobility of these towers ensures that illumination can move with the project, ensuring optimal lighting from all angles.

In the event industry, mobile LED lighting towers enhance outdoor festivals, concerts, and sporting events, creating a safe environment for crowds while ensuring performers and staff can work effectively. Event planners can rely on these systems for quick and easy setup, allowing for more flexible staging options and enhancing the overall attendee experience.

In emergency response and public safety sectors, mobile LED lighting towers are crucial for illuminating accident sites, search and rescue operations, and disaster recovery efforts. Being immediately deployable, they provide first responders with the necessary lighting to work safely and efficiently, facilitating rapid assistance during critical scenarios. Their importance in these contexts cannot be overstated, as lives can depend on effective and timely lighting solutions.
